Cheap astronomy binoculars

How about an astronomy binocular that does not need a tripod? How about an astronomy binocular that is still small enough to be used for other binocular applications like birding, wildlife, scenery and so on? Is there such an astronomy binocular? Yes, there is. A 10x50 has pretty much replaced the older 7x50 as the classic handheld astronomy binocular for many people and the good news is that there are many value priced 10x50 binoculars that will do a good job. Some of the best bang for the buck astronomy/universal binoculars include the Nikon Action Extreme 10x50, the Celestron Outland LX 10x50, the Bushnell Legend 10x50 and the Leupold Wind River Meas 10x50 Astronomy can be an expensive hobby, but it does not have to be. Best of all, any of these astronomy binoculars are better than my first binocular I used forty years ago.
